Rengeki (連撃) - Japanese for "combo attack", is a type of special attack in The World R:2. After breaking the opponent's defenses through a series of combo attacks, purple and black rings will surround the opponent, during which a player can perform a Rengeki by activating one of their combat skills. This doubles damage done by the attacker for the duration of the skill and also increases the experience gained at the end of the fight (a Rengeki bonus). Physical damage-based classes with higher attack speeds and lower attack power, such as Tribal Grappler and Twin Blade, have an easier time achieving Rengeki through their speed, while slower classes such as Edge Punisher may need extra help despite the fewer number of hits they require. Dual Gunner usually has the easiest time with combos, but is offset by the fact that it takes a large number of regular attacks before a Rengeki opportunity arises. The magic-based classes Harvest Cleric and Shadow Warlock have the hardest time inducing Rengeki and often need to fall back on their spells for help in order to do so, though the Macabre Dancer class lacks this weakness. Rengeki is achieved based on the number of hits delivered and what weapons and skills contributed rather than damage dealt, much like Protect Break in the original games, but unlike Protect Break, Rengeki will only become available after a regular attack. Skills can contribute to inducing Rengeki, but cannot activate the rings. Certain weapon modifications allow any class to perform Rengeki after much less than the usual number of regular attacks, but these same modifications don't affect skills.
Awakenings (覚醒) are special attacks in the .hack//G.U. games that can be performed when the Morale bar is full. The bar can be filled by performing Rengeki attacks with other party members that are alive to bare witness, fulfilling other conditions and actions that party members like, and/or by performing Hangeki in the Arena. These attacks, for the length of their duration, strip the enemy of equipment effects and any abilities other than walking, rendering them helpless to whatever onslaught they may face. They also cure any status ailments affecting the living members of the party using the Awakening, that they may have had prior to the attack.
Beast Awakening (武獣覚醒) - The speed and attack power of the awakened party is increased for the duration of the Awakening. It is commonly used in the Arena. In Reminisce and Redemption, Beast Awakening only requires at least half of the Morale bar to be filled before it can be used, but the less Morale a player has going into an Awakening, the faster the drain on that Morale will be, shortening the Awakening's duration even further.
Demon Awakening (魔導覚醒) - The leader of the attacking party casts a first level attack spell at the enemy repeatedly for the duration of the Awakening by tapping attack. The spell chosen always opposes the element of the first keyword. In the Arena, it is completely random on each use because there are no area words whatsoever for accessing the three Palaces. Allies cannot help out during this Awakening. Instead, they are locked by the leader's side in an attack pose. In Reminisce and Redemption, Demon Awakening only requires at least half of the Morale bar to be filled before it can be used, but the less Morale a player has going into an Awakening, the faster the drain on Morale will be, shortening the Awakening's duration even further.
